WebMar 24, 2024 · The nth roots of unity are roots e^(2piik/n) of the cyclotomic equation x^n=1, which are known as the de Moivre numbers. The notations zeta_k, epsilon_k, and epsilon_k, where the value of n is understood by context, are variously used to denote the kth nth root of unity. +1 is always an nth root of unity, but -1 is such a root only if n is even. WebSep 28, 2024 · Roots of Unity Filters combinatorics complex-numbers summation contest-math 1,439 Solution 1 ∑ ( n 3 k + 1) = 1 2 ( 1 + 1) n + ω 2 ( 1 + ω) n + ω ( 1 + ω 2) n 3 … WebSep 23, 2024 · Roots of unity are the roots of the polynomials of the form xn – 1. For example, when n = 2, this gives us the quadratic polynomial x2 – 1. To find its roots, just set it equal to 0 and solve: x2 – 1 = 0. You might remember factoring expressions like this using the “difference of squares” formula, which says that a2 – b2 = ( a – b ) ( a + b ). WebMar 6, 2024 · where [math]\displaystyle{ \omega = e^{\frac{2\pi i}{q}} }[/math] is a primitive q-th root of unity. This expression is often called a root of unity filter. This solution was first discovered by Thomas Simpson. This expression is especially useful in that it can convert an infinite sum into a finite sum.
